NanoLog – A <17KB Shadow DOM widget for changelogs and roadmaps

ahm-labs1 pts0 comments

NanoLog | The Lightweight Changelog & Feedback Widget

Now launching in Early Access<br>The zero-bloat product engagement changelog widget suite for SaaS.<br>A single, unified 3-in-1 platform for your in-app product changelog, interactive user roadmaps, and secure inbound feedback . Replaces Canny, Beamer, and Userback with a standalone that preserves your Lighthouse score.<br>Start building for free →View live demo<br>No credit card required. Setup in 2 minutes.

What's New<br>Latest updates from the team

Updates<br>Roadmap<br>Feedback

Works Where You Work

Built for modern SaaS teams<br>2 min<br>Setup time

Widget bundle

Dependencies

100%<br>Shadow DOM isolated

Tailored Value PillarsBuilt for every side of your team<br>Whether you maintain secure architecture, prioritize releases, or write integration loops, NanoLog solves your exact challenges.

CTO<br>For CTOs & Leaders<br>Security, Performance & Diagnostics<br>✓Cryptographic HMAC verification limits voting to authenticated users<br>✓Strict Shadow DOM isolation prevents legacy CSS layout conflicts<br>✓Under 17KB CDNs preserve Lighthouse & Core Web Vitals at 100/100<br>✓Real-time OS, browser parameters and console log debug diagnostic uploads

Learn secure specs→

CPO<br>For Product Teams<br>Adoption, Feedback & Roadmaps<br>✓Consolidated Changelog + Roadmap + Feedback under 1 unified widget invoice<br>✓Engage cohorts instantly by sending updates sole to target customer segments<br>✓In-app NPS emoji ratings, reaction charts, and feature upvote campaigns<br>✓Visual feedback screenshots with drawings to report product bugs

Maximize product conversion→<br>DEV<br>For Developers<br>Integration, APIs & Extensibility<br>✓Boot in less than 2 minutes using standard client window init hooks<br>✓TypeScript definitions, native ESM packages, and absolute framework support<br>✓Complete whitelabel flexibility, custom CSS variables, and trigger bindings<br>✓Zero dependency bundle keeps your engineering velocity clean and fast

Explore CDN & API Docs→

How it works<br>Setup in minutes, not days.<br>NanoLog is designed to get out of your way. Integrate it once, and let your product managers handle the rest.

Copy the snippet<br>Paste a single tag into your app. It loads a native web component without bloating your bundle or conflicting with your styles.

Write your updates<br>Use our markdown editor to draft release logs, feature announcements, or bug fixes. Hit publish to instantly push them to your live app.

Collect feedback<br>Your users see the updates directly in your app. They can leave feedback, give reactions, and view your roadmap, keeping them engaged.

Live Interactive Sandbox<br>See NanoLog in action<br>Interact with our core features below and see why developers and product managers love our technical foundations.

Select a USP to explore<br>CSS Style Isolation<br>Native Shadow DOM encapsulation blocks styling bleeding completely.<br>Cohort Targeting<br>Deliver targeted release notes and updates to specific user groups.<br>Unified 3-in-1 Platform<br>Announcements, feedback collection, and live roadmaps inside one widget.

Shadow DOM IsolationZero CSS Leakage. Period.<br>Widgets that sit in your main application DOM often get broken by your app's global stylesheets (e.g. huge font sizes, color changes, layout issues). NanoLog isolates all styles using a native Web Component Shadow DOM.

Isolated (Shadow DOM)Broken (Global Styles Bleeding)<br>Host ApplicationLive View<br>NanoLog Widget<br>Latest release notes for your dashboard application.<br>Acknowledge Update

Toggle states to visualize styling bleeding issues common to non-encapsulated widgets.

Developer First ImpressionsPraise from Closed Beta Testers<br>Read what early SaaS engineers and technical founders say about our CSS isolation and bundle footprint.

"We run a historic vinyl store in Rotherham, and we wanted a frictionless way to let our regulars know when new collectible shipments land without spamming their inbox. NanoLog's inline changelog widget works perfectly as a blog announcement feed. Setup took less than 5 minutes and fits our vintage dark-mode theme beautifully!"

JS<br>Jason Sayles<br>CEO @ Riverside Records (Rotherham)

"Keeping our members updated on weekly karaoke nights, pub quizzes, and members-only events is vital for Swinton House. Using the NanoLog widget as a live, interactive announcement feed directly on our homepage has driven incredible engagement. Our weekly event attendance is up noticeably!"

MC<br>Club Manager<br>Manager @ Swinton House Club

"The cryptographically secure HMAC validation was a firm requirement for our enterprise customers to prevent duplicate voting or feedback spam. Setting it up was simple and standard. Highly engineered solution."

AT<br>Aris Thorne<br>Head of Engineering @ AuthGuard

Live Production Spotlights & Case Studies<br>Riverside Records<br>Storefront<br>Rotherham's premier independent vinyl, memorabilia, and soul record store.<br>The Challenge: Announcing rare collectibles, fresh vinyl arrivals, and special shop orders without building a custom database and email newsletter loop.<br>The Solution: Implemented...

feedback nanolog widget shadow product live

Related Articles